Maha Kumbh 2025 Viral Video: Reaching Prayagraj for Maha Kumbh 2025 has become a major challenge, with massive crowds, traffic congestion, and skyrocketing flight fares. A Maha Kumbh 2025 viral video reportedly from Patna Railway Station captures the desperation of passengers as they push and shove to board the Rajdhani Express. Overcrowded platforms and chaotic boarding scenes highlight the struggle of devotees trying to reach the holy event.
The viral video, shared by X (formerly Twitter) user Sukesh Ranjan, shows thousands of passengers crammed onto the platform. The caption reads, “Look at the crowd of people going to Maha Kumbh at Patna Station. This is the picture of Rajdhani Express on Tuesday night.” As soon as the train arrived, the situation turned chaotic, with people attempting to enter an already packed train.

Surprisingly, this was not a regular train but the Rajdhani Express, one of India’s premium trains with high-ticket fares. The Maha Kumbh 2025 viral video shows a completely jam-packed train with no space to step inside, yet people kept trying to board. The incident has raised concerns about railway safety and crowd management ahead of the grand religious gathering.
The video has been viewed over 144k times, sparking heated discussions online. Many users criticised the mismanagement and reckless boarding practices.
